Baring the shoulders has swiftly become a Style phenomenon for those experiencing warm summer days or even just the warmer days from beachside at a tropical locale. Baring the shoulders, like exposing the back is a wonderfully feminine way of featuring one part of the body without baring too much. Besides, there is something so charismatic about a woman in a Shoulder-baring top. If you are not enthralled with the back-out clothing styles that are so prevalent I hope you can agree that baring the shoulders is captivating and just a bit sexy. It may not be as sexy as a cut-out back top or dress but that is not what lies in its appeal anyway; at least not for me.







I still remember watching my favorite films starts in the late 1940s and 1950s wearing the shoulder-baring tops and dresses that were a tad daring yet boldly feminine. I equate film noir actresses such as Rita Hayworth with making me sit-up and pay attention to this fashion style. She gave off an air of allure while singing and sometimes dancing while wearing off-the-shoulder outfits in the many roles she inhabited. Of course, she was far from the only beauty icon that adorned herself in shoulder-baring outfits.

There were many more celebrities whom were fond of baring their shoulders. Among them are Dorothy Dandridge, Grace Kelly, Elizabeth Taylor and Marilyn Monroe. Off-the-shoulders dresses equated to a common elegance not just for the 1950s bit for today.

Shoulder-baring tops and dresses look superb with a strand of pearls and elbow-length gloves for formal events or paired with casual attire and accessories.  Off-the shoulder dresses and tops are rather a chic way to look cool when it’s hot.

If you don’t have a shoulder-baring top it is quite effortless to turn a cowl neck top into one.  A little adjustments here and there will have you joining the off-the-shoulder crowd in no time at all. I have turned my cowl-neck tops into shoulder-baring tops quicker than you can say no way. I have been so inspired by the many ways even a button-down shirt can be turned into an off-the-shoulder shirt. Over-sized sweaters also lend themselves to this neat trick. There are many quick-change artists out there. Isn’t that what makes fashion so grand?
 
 
 
 
 








Off-the-shoulder tops, by the way, look charming with the 1970s pants’ styles that are all the rage right now. Both flare-leg and wide-leg pants alike look out of this world with off-the shoulder tops; however, if you are not a fan of these pant leg styles try pairing them with a structured pencil skirt or skinny jeans. They also create quite an impactful look.
